Eclipse Developments (WA) Pty is a company incorporated in October 2003. It has two shareholders, two managing directors and a company secretary. Directors Mr. Stephen Collins of PO Box 1131, MANDURAH WA 6210 Mr. Peter Wright of PO Box 1131, MANDURAH WA 6210 Company Secretary Mr Stephen Collins of PO Box 1131, MANDURAH WA 6210 Operation Eclipse Developments (WA) Pty Ltd operates and trades from premises at Unit 4, 12 Tindale Street MANDURAH WA 6210. Its principle business is construction contracting. It has 5-8 full time employees and engages the services of approximately 100 sub-contractors at any one time. Eclipse Developments (WA) Pty Ltd would be the entity that would enter into a contract with the principal. As a Mandurah based construction company, Eclipse Developments (WA) Pty Ltd have been operating since 2003 headed by Directors, Stephen Collins and Peter Wright. Eclipse strives to be one of the leading construction companies in the Peel region in both commercial and residential fields. Eclipse target areas of work in industrial and commercial developments, local and state government projects as well as luxury homes.

Customer Service Charter Who are we, what we do and what you can expect from us? Eclipse Development (WA) P/L - established in 2003 by Co-directors Peter Wright and Stephen Collins having worked together on numerous construction projects in the United Kingdom and Australia since 1985. Initially specialising in large domestic extensions, renovations and individually designed high quality homes Eclipse expanded the company over the next 5 years incorporating multi storey apartments and commercial developments. The company currently employs an average of 5-8 direct staff and approximately 85-100 subcontractors at any one time. Each project is assigned a supervisor and an administrator, one of the company directors takes responsibility to oversee and manage the project and track compliance, progress, quality and customer satisfaction. Unless specified otherwise by the client or their superintendent Eclipse holds fortnightly meetings to report on:
Safety performance Actual progress against planned progress Delays and reasons EOT (Extensions of Time) claims Quality compliance Variations to the contract works RFI (Requests for Information) resolution Planned work for the coming fortnight General Business
Eclipse Customers and Clients Our customers and clients range from:
Private individuals building two to three storey luxury homes and apartments Developers building multi storey apartments for sale or lease Investors building commercial buildings and restaurants for leasing DHW (Department of Housing & Works) Public Buildings DTF (Department for Treasury and Finance) School Buildings Local Government Shires and Cities building sporting facilities

Eclipse Sub-Contractors Eclipse Developments (WA) Pty Ltd pre-qualifies its subcontractors prior to engagement, thorough reference checks are carried out and include one of the company directors viewing the subcontractors previous work to ensure it achieves the Eclipse high standard and expectations. SMP’s (Safety Management Plans) are issued to all companies under the control of Eclipse outlining the safety requirements and procedures for the works, a risk assessment is carried out and incorporated in the site specific induction for all workers and visitors. Your Concerns and Complaints When an issue arises Eclipse are committed to dealing with faults, concerns or complaints promptly, fairly, completely and courteously informing clients and customers of how we propose to act, how long it should take and what the results of our findings are. Unless specified otherwise by the client or their superintendent Eclipse holds fortnightly meetings to report on: Safety performance Actual progress against planned progress (MS Project updated for each meeting) Delays and reasons EOT (Extensions of Time) claims Quality compliance Variations to the contract works RFI (Requests for Information) resolution Planned work for the coming fortnight General Business
Eclipse has a tried and tested system for effective communication and consultation not only with the clients and their superintendent but also with its subcontractors. All communication, verbal or e-mail is followed up with numerical correspondence in the form of RFI’s (Request for Information) Notices or Directives. These communications are recorded and reviewed at the site meetings with the client’s superintendent to identify any outstanding unanswered queries or unresolved actions.
Minutes of all meetings are recorded and issued by Eclipse within a maximum of 5 working days of each meeting; these minutes also show an action list and timeline for actions to be completed. Demonstrated Understanding- Methodology
Following award of a project or a client’s letter of intent, all projects carried out by Eclipse Developments (WA) Pty Ltd are subjected to a thorough project risk assessment, a subsequent project specific safety management plan plus a very detailed construction program, from these 3 documents, risks to safety, schedule and cost are identified and any anomalies are communicated and addressed with the relevant parties. Program of Works As mentioned earlier, a very detailed program is critical to achieving the date for practical completion, Eclipse updates the program for each fortnightly meeting and distributes them to all interested parties and contractors when changes occur, Eclipse includes lead times for long lead items and notification reminders for utilities who require longer and longer to schedule their technicians for site. Eclipse has an excellent record with its ability to achieve the critical dates for projects as the referees will verify. If a delay occurs it is communicated promptly so that all are aware and suitable amendments to the program can be issued. Variations Since inception, Eclipse Developments (WA) Pty Ltd have adopted an open book policy in regards to variations; variations are open to manipulation by subcontractors at the expense of the client and the builder. Eclipse wherever possible reviews the variation for value for money prior to presenting them to the client to prevent this occurring.
